WebIn the arc-node data structure, arcs connect to each other at nodes and have both a from-node (i.e., starting node) indicating where the arc begins and a to-node (i.e., ending node) indicating where the arc ends. This is called arc-node topology. Arc-node topology is supported through an arc-node list.
